Mystic Valley Girls Win Two, Make Tourney

 

The Mystic Valley Lady Eagles qualified for the MIAA tournament this past Friday by virtue of a 44-27 victory over Chelsea High. The win, their 10th of the season, did not come easily as Chelsea was able to make things difficult for the Lady Eagles in the first half. “It was a 4-6 point game for most of the first half” said Coach Jason Cantwell. “We weren’t able to start to pull away until the final minutes of the first half, the surge was keyed by a Bailey Chiccuarelli steal and basket to make the lead 10 at the half(25-15). In the third quarter, the Lady Eagles extended the lead to 14 before eventually settling for a 17 point victory.

The lady Eagles were led in the scoring column by freshman Meghan Foley (12 points, 8 rebounds and 7 steals), sophomore Paulina Petras (8 points, 11 rebounds) senior Jordan Sullivan (8 points) and sophomore Jessica Phinney (7 points). “I was proud of the girls today, they played through some adversity early when the calls weren’t going our way, we were able to keep our composure and play through it. It was by far our best game from the free throw line as well (7 for 9).

The girls got a leg up in the race for the CAC Division 2 title Tuesday with a 47-35 at Greater Lawrence. The girls broke the game open in the second quarter, outscoring Greater Lawrence 23-2. Freshman Meghan Foley again led the way with 20 points, and Junior Tania Fabo came off the bench to score 10 points and grab 17 rebounds.

With the win the girls improve to 11-2 on the season and 6-0 in conference play. The girls can clinch at least a share of the conference title with a win next Friday, at home against PMA. The girls return to the court next Tuesday at Notre Dame Academy of Tyngsboro.
